The right answer is Option C.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given equations are;

-2x+4y=17   Eqn 1

3x-10y= -3   Eqn 2

Adding Eqn 1 and Eqn 2;

[tex](-2x+4y)+(3x-10y)=17+(-3)\\-2x+4y+3x-10y=17-3\\3x-2x-10y+4y=14\\x-6y=14[/tex]

The right answer is Option C.
